About our organization: LLRIBHS promotes health in our communities for the wellbeing of all members.  We provide accessible, high quality health services and programs. Together with others, we work to build capacity and educate as we address both acute needs and the determinants of health.
About the position:  The HR Technician will support the HR Program by providing information to applicants and employees; maintaining records; completing assigned projects and tasks; and resolving a variety of employee issues. The Human Resource Technician plans, organizes, directs and controls the operations of human resources and personnel. This position assists the HR Coordinator with planning, recruitment, training and development, and benefits administration.
